5. ¿Àµð¼Ç °î



* Piano Àü°ø

ÇлçÇÐÀ§(Undergraduate)/ ´ëÇпø(Graduate)

* All works are to be performed from memory.
-Baroque: a prelude and fugue from the Bach Well-Tempered
an equivalent Baroque work
-Classical: a complete sonata in traditional form, or comparable
work
-Romantic: a major work of the applicant¡¯s choice
-20th Century: a work by a major composer such as Bartok,
Ravel, Prokofiev, Copland, lves, Schoenberg, or Messiaen

 

 

* Violin / Cello/ Viola / Double Bassµî Çö¾Ç±â

ÇлçÇÐÀ§(Undergraduate)

* Instrumental auditions must be performed without accompaniment.
-An etude or technical study
-Two movements of unaccompanied Bach. Bass players may substitute with another work of their choice
-A complete movement from the standard concerto repertoire
-Using the Schott or International Edition Orchestral Excerpt books:
select one excerpt from a Mozart Symphony and one excerpt from any Romantic period orchestral work.
-Please prepare all major and minor scales(minimum 4 notes slurred per bow) and arpeggios (3 notes slurred per bow).
-Recorded auditions should include one major and one minor scale and arpeggio of your choice.

¼®»çÇÐÀ§(Graduate)

*Instrumental auditions must be performed without accompaniment.
-An etude or technical study.
-Two movements of unaccompanied Bach.
-A complete movement from the standard concerto repertoire.
-A work of the applicant¡¯s choice (a 20th century work is recommended).
-Using the Schott or International Edition Orchestral Excerpt books:
select two excerpts from the symphonies of Mozart #35-41 and two
excerpts from a Brahms symphony.
-Please prepare all major and minor scales (minimum 4 notes slurred per bow) and arpeggios (3 notes slurred per bow). Recorded auditions should include one major and one minor scale and arpeggio of your choice.

 

* Voice Àü°ø -¿©¼º voice Pre-screening CD ÇÊ¿ä

ÇлçÇÐÀ§(Undergraduate):

* All works are to be performed from memory.
For auditions in Boston at The Boston Conservatory an accompanist will be provided.
Applicants must be prepared to perform all of the following:
-An Italian art song from the 17th or 18th century
-An art song in German or French
-An art song in English (not in translation)
* No operatic arias please.

¼®»çÇÐÀ§(Graduate):

For auditions in Boston at The Boston Conservatory an accompanist will be provided.
Applicants must be prepared to perform all of the following:
-An Italian art song
-An art song in German
-An art song in French
-An art song in English (not a translation)
-Optional: an aria from an opera or oratorio

* ÀÛ°î Àü°ø (Composition)

-Submission of a portfolio of between two and five works (no more), at least one of which must be for two or more instruments.
-Scores should be legibly notated (by hand or by computer) photo
copied (double-sided), and bound.
-Recordings of your work are encouraged.
-Make sure that there is an accompanying score for each submitted
recording.
-Write a short essay describing your musical influences and enthusiasms and what you hope to achieve as a composer.
-Applicants may be asked to interview, in which case an in-person interview is preferred.
-In exceptional circumstances a telephone interview may be arranged.

 

* Flute / Bassoon/ Clarinet/ Oboe/ Saxophone µî Woodwinds Àü°ø

ÇлçÇÐÀ§(Undergraduate):

* Instrumental auditions must be performed without accompaniment.
-An etude
-Two movements of a contrasting nature from a sonata or concerto

¼®»çÇÐÀ§(Graduate):

Instrumental auditions must be performed without accompaniment.
Two movements of contrasting nature from the solo repertoire and two orchestral excerpts
